&Travel Advisories A Passport and visa are required
for entry into the U.A.E. (except for GCC Nationals). The passport must be valid
for at least six months. Sponsors are not required, but applicants may be asked
to provide an invitational letter to confirm the purpose of travel. These visas
do not permit employment in the U.A.E. With 2-3 weeks advance
notice (sometimes less), a local sponsor (company, major hotel or U.A.E. Government
agency) can arrange for a transit visa valid for a single stay of up to two weeks. Local
sponsors (companies or individuals) can also arrange for visitor visas valid for
one month with extensions possible of up to three months upon application. Visit
Visas
Visit visas, also refered to as tourist
visas, are given to individuals who will be spending over 14 days in the UAE.
The list below contains countries that don't require a visit visa before entering

Tourism Visas
A transit visa can be issued by
the sponsorship of an airline operating in the UAE, which is a 4-day (96 hour)
visa, to individuals individuals who have a valid ticket for an onward flight.
An Entry Service Permit is identical to a visit visa, except it is a 14-day visa.
Health certificate
Not required. An AIDS test is mandatory for obtaining a residence permit which
is a must for all expatriates and their dependents living in the U.A.E. The test
has to be conducted in the U.A.E. by the Preventive Medicine Unit.
